Abstract

The objectives of this research are to  define and comprehensively analyze the influence  of  work  family  conflict  and  role  ambiguity  towards  intention  to  quit  by conducting  work  stress  as  the  intervening  variable.  This  research  was  conducted  by passing the questionaires to 50 staffs in Grand Edge Hotel, Semarang.It applied multiple regression as method   analysing the data. In testng the data, validity test, reliability test, classical assumption test, and determinant coefficient test, F test, T test, and Test of Sobel were conducted in order to check the mediation effectAs the result, it showed that work family conflict was positively and significanly influenced  work  stress  and  intention  to  quite,  role  ambiguity  was  positively  and significanly influenced work stress and intention to quite. Work stress   was to mediate relation between work family conflict and role ambiguity towards intention to quit.
